Ankhiyon Ke Jharokhon Se (1978) Characters, Setting & Themes Explained

Release, runtime and language
1978 · 135 mins · Hindi
Directed by
Hiren Nag
Starring
Sachin Pilgaonkar, Ranjeeta Kaur, Iftekhar, Urmila Bhatt, Madan Puri

A young man must deal with a broken engagement ceremony, while his to-be fiancée waits to be treated for blood cancer.

5 main characters · contains spoilers

Ankhiyon Ke Jharokhon Se Characters Explained: Who Is Who

The main characters of Ankhiyon Ke Jharokhon Se (1978), heroes and villains: what drives them, how they change over the course of the story and what each of them reveals about the film's bigger ideas.

  • Arun Prakash Mathur – Sachin Pilgaonkar

    Arun is the son of a barrister and the self-proclaimed prince among male students. When he places second in the Terminal Examination, his pride is bruised, fueling a personal vendetta to crush Lily's rising popularity. Over time, his attitude softens as he and Lily discover their true qualities, and he falls deeply in love. After Lily's leukemia changes everything, he endures a devastating heartbreak but remains devoted, promising to remember her forever.

  • Lily Fernandes – Ranjeeta Kaur

    Lily is the modest daughter of a nurse who outshines Arun in the Terminal Examination and becomes the object of his envy. She endures his sarcasm with grace, never harboring ill will. As they slowly reveal their true qualities to each other, a quiet romance blossoms. Her illness with leukemia becomes the defining moment, and her strength and kindness leave a lasting impact on Arun, even as he mourns.

  • Ruby Fernandes – Urmila Bhatt

    Lily's mother, a nurse by profession, notices the budding romance between Lily and Arun. She is the first to sense their love and is ultimately torn between concerns about social status and the desire to support her daughter's happiness. Her shifting stance evolves from caution to supportive guidance as the relationships deepens.

  • Hari Prakash Mathur – Madan Puri

    Arun's father, a barrister who values reputation and propriety. He approves the marriage proposal between the two families, bridging social gaps and providing a pragmatic, supportive stance. His involvement underscores the importance of family consent and social acceptance in the couple's decisions.

3 major themes

Ankhiyon Ke Jharokhon Se Meaning: Themes & Message Explained

What is Ankhiyon Ke Jharokhon Se (1978) really about? The emotional, social and philosophical themes the film keeps returning to, its symbolism and the message beneath the surface.

  • Love vs Class

    Two teenagers from different social backgrounds fall in love despite expectations. Arun's vanity clashes with Lily's humility, yet their bond deepens as they share meaningful moments away from social pressure. The romance challenges the town's rigid norms and highlights how affection can bridge gaps. Ultimately, their connection reveals character more than social status.

  • Illness and Mortality

    Lily's leukemia becomes the turning point of the story, testing loyalties and courage. The illness exposes vulnerabilities in families and friends while forcing choices about care and hope. The treatment journey underscores the fragility of life and the inevitability of loss. The film uses illness to illuminate love’s endurance beyond death.

  • Growth and Memory

    Arun's journey moves from pride to humility as he learns to value Lily's life more than social standing. The couple's memories act as a guiding light for him after her passing. The seaside finale marks a vow to carry her inspiration forward. The story suggests that love can catalyze personal growth and lasting memory.

What is the emotional tone of the film?

The film shifts dramatically in tone - the first half is lighter and hopeful as a sweet romance develops and gains parental approval. The second half becomes overwhelmingly melancholic and tragic, dominated by Lily's illness and eventual death, creating a heavy and devastating emotional experience.
